The Naval Air Systems Command (NAVAIR), Patuxent River, MD, intends to award a contract to The Boeing Company for the procurement of obsolescence efforts for a Radio Frequency Blanker Unit (RFBU) and the associated non-recurring engineering (NRE) and integration of the Advanced Tactical System Hardware Build 2.2 (ANTS HB 2.2) to support the development of the MQ-25A program. In addition, this award will include the replacement of the Encrypted Mass Storage Solution with a new form, fit, function data transfer system (DTS) 1+ with software changes.
For this proposed action, the Government intends to solicit and negotiate with only one source under the authority of 10 U.S.C.3204(a)(l) and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Subpart 6.302-1, "Only one responsible source and no other type of suppliers or services will satisfy agency requirements." Boeing is the sole designer, developer, and manufacturer of the MQ-25A unmanned aircraft and therefore, Boeing is the only contractor with the experienced staff, necessary plants, equipment, suppliers, and technical understanding of what is required by the contract, resulting in the unique capability to address the interrelated impacts on each other and on the MQ-25A program.
